DWAZ #45 – “THE CAVES OF ANDROZANI”
This week we discuss one of the greatest Doctor Who stories of all time—“The Caves of Androzani” from Season 21. This was the final Fifth Doctor story; it starred Peter Davison and Nicola Bryant, was written by Robert Holmes, and directed by Graeme Harper. The Doctor and Peri get caught up in a vicious local war and are exposed to a deadly poison, and they struggle to simply make it out of the situation alive.

DWAZ #35 - The Road to 60: "The Five Doctors"
This week, Josh and Alan review the story that introduced both of them to Doctor Who -- the epic 20th anniversary story, "The Five Doctors"! It's a race against time and a bevy of enemies as the various incarnations of the Doctor try to make it to the Dark Tower in the heart of the Death Zone on Gallifrey to thwart President Borusa's bid for immortality. Written by Terrance Dicks, directed by Peter Moffat, "The Five Doctors" stars Peter Davison, Jon Pertwee, Patrick Troughton and Richard Hurndall.

DWAZ #30 - The Road to 60: "The Girl Who Waited"
It's two big thumbs up this week from Josh and Alan, as we jump back into the Eleventh Doctor era with "The Girl Who Waited" from Series 6. It was written by Tom MacRae and directed by Nick Hurran, and it stars Matt Smith as the Doctor, Karen Gillan as Amy, and Arthur Darvill as Rory. The TARDIS gang pays a visit to the planet Apalapucia for a holiday, but they find that the planet is in quarantine as the two-hearted natives are susceptible to a deadly plague. Amy accidentally gets separated from the Doctor and Rory but, when they try to rescue her, they arrive 36 years later in her timeline.

DWZA #29 - The Road to 60: "The Romans"
This week your hosts Josh and Alan actually do tackle one of the all-time greats of Doctor Who -- "The Romans" from Season Two (1965), starring William Hartnell (The Doctor), Jacqueline Hill (Barbara), William Russell (Ian) and Maureen O'Brien (Vicki) and features Derek Francis (Nero). The Doctor and Vicki investigate intrigue surrounding the death of a lyre player en route to perform at the palace of Emperor Nero in London. Meanwhile, Barbara is sold as a slave at auction and Ian is thrown into the lions' den.

DWAZ #28 - The Road to 60: "Nightmare of Eden"
This week Josh and Alan tackle one of the true greats (okay, maybe not), one of the undisputed epics (yeah, not so much), one of the absolute titans (not even close) of Doctor Who -- that's right, it's "Nightmare of Eden" from Season 17! Written by Bob Baker (or is that Barker?) and directed by Alan Bromly (at least for a little while), "Nightmare" stars Tom Baker, Lalla Ward and David Brierly. The TARDIS gang encounters two ships that have collided in a partially dematerialised state, carrying a bunch of drug smugglers, a supply of the deadly drug, and a scope that holds creatures and their environments from different planets in miniaturised form (wait, haven't we already seen that in "Carnival of Monsters"???). It's a production that was so fraught with difficulty that it made its director quit midway through and made both the producer and the script editor turn in their resignations!

DWA2Z #6: The Road to 60 - "Survival' (with composer Dominic Glynn)
As we continue to hit highlights from the first 59 years of the show leading up to the 60th Anniversary in 2023, I'm joined by Dominic Glynn, composer on Seasons 23 - 26 of the original series, to talk about the final broadcast story, "Survival." We chat about Dominic's first impression of the story back in 1989, his approach to scoring it, and what makes "Survival" unique in the Doctor Who canon, before talking about some of his recent work, particularly his score for the BAFTA Award-winning documentary, Eye of the Storm.
